The Office of Development, in conjunction with parishes throughout the Archdiocese, sponsors Planned Giving Seminars throughout the year. These seminars are led by local Estate Planning attorneys. The seminars are a great way to gain up-to-date and trustworthy information about Planned Giving.

Estate Planning Seminars:
Reducing estate taxes, avoiding probate, and providing for heirs will be among the topics treated at our estate planning seminars. The free seminar topics will include life support systems and your legal rights, saving taxes when selling stock or real estate, probate, wills life income plans, and other crucial estate planning issues. With the present tax reforms of individual estate tax exemptions and the decrease of the maximum gift tax, there are changes occurring that you need to hear for your Estate Plan.
